Joe Bald Park
Joe Bald Park is a public boat ramp on White River - Table Rock Lake near Lampe, Missouri. This beginner-level spot offers kayaking, canoeing, paddleboarding. Amenities include boat ramp, parking. Best visited in spring and summer and fall.

About This Location
Launch into White River - Table Rock Lake near Lampe, Missouri. Beginner level with calm and sheltered water.
Joe Bald Park is a public access point on White River - Table Rock Lake in Missouri, giving paddlers a convenient entry to the lake.
This is a solid spot for kayaking, with enough room to settle into a comfortable paddling rhythm. Canoeing works well here, especially for those looking for a peaceful day on the water. Midwestern waterways provide reliable paddling through the warmer months, with vast open spaces and uncrowded conditions.
Expect calm and sheltered conditions on the water. The best time to visit is March through November. Facilities include boat ramp and parking.
Joe Bald Park sits about 5 min from Lampe, making it a convenient option for local and visiting paddlers.
